SAVE Tonic
This is one of the more adventurous musical outlets in New York, with a genre-bending mix of jazz, rock and experimental electronica music / performance ... they are going under. Help save them.

Please help by going to their benefit concerts, or donating money, or meeting lots of friends there and getting pissed. It is located at 107 Norfolk Street in the lower eastside (F train to delancey).

The downstairs bar has tables in barrels. nuff said.
